Bruce Waayne 3 August 2012
Good: to whom it may concern, as most of the smart phones Galaxy S advance has the A2DP Bluetooth technology (Advanced Audio Distribution Profile) which allow you to pair a Bluetooth Stereo handsets or speaker , and am really quit sure that most of the people doesn't know that Galaxy S2 doesn't support the A2DP technology> So we can simply tell that Galaxy Advance has beat the S2 regarding this issue. How Come Galaxy S2 doesn't support A2DP !!! Galaxy S advance has DLNA technology same as in Galaxy S2, for those who doesn't know what is DLNA watch the following http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=z38E1_rya58
Bad: No ICS official upgrade / no MHL / no USB On-the-go / no Camera image stabilization
Comment: Perfect comparing to it's price , really recommended

DavetheBassGuy 5 July 2012
Good: dual core, nice design
Comment: Anyone considering this phone would be better off getting a second hand galaxy S or SII. I have the Galaxy S and it runs Ice Cream Sandwich very well (AOKP ROM). I know it's not dual core but the increased performance in ICS make up for this.
